All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] ARM: OMAP2+: CLEANUP: Remove ARCH_OMAPx ifdef from struct dpll_data
@ 2012-05-11  6:02 ` Vaibhav Hiremath
  0 siblings, 0 replies; 12+ messages in thread
From: Vaibhav Hiremath @ 2012-05-11  6:02 UTC (permalink / raw)
  To: linux-omap
  Cc: linux-arm-kernel, Kevin Hilman, Vaibhav Hiremath, Tony Lindgren,
	Paul Walmsley, Santosh Shilimkar, R Sricharan

From: Kevin Hilman <khilman@ti.com>

There are certain fields inside 'struct dpll_data' which are
included under ARCH_OMAP3 and ARCH_OMAP4 option, which makes it
difficult to use it for new devices like, am33xx, ti81xx, etc...

So remove the ifdef completely, this will add few fields to the struct
unused, but it improves readability and maintainability of the code.

Signed-off-by: Kevin Hilman <khilman@ti.com>
Signed-off-by: Vaibhav Hiremath <hvaibhav@ti.com>
Cc: Tony Lindgren <tony@atomide.com>
Cc: Paul Walmsley <paul@pwsan.com>
Cc: Santosh Shilimkar <santosh.shilimkar@ti.com>
Cc: R Sricharan <r.sricharan@ti.com>
---
Since Kevin had provided this idea and code change,
making this patch under his authorship.

 arch/arm/plat-omap/include/plat/clock.h |    2 --
 1 files changed, 0 insertions(+), 2 deletions(-)

diff --git a/arch/arm/plat-omap/include/plat/clock.h b/arch/arm/plat-omap/include/plat/clock.h
index d0ef57c..656b986 100644
--- a/arch/arm/plat-omap/include/plat/clock.h
+++ b/arch/arm/plat-omap/include/plat/clock.h
@@ -156,7 +156,6 @@ struct dpll_data {
 	u8			min_divider;
 	u16			max_divider;
 	u8			modes;
-#if defined(CONFIG_ARCH_OMAP3) || defined(CONFIG_ARCH_OMAP4)
 	void __iomem		*autoidle_reg;
 	void __iomem		*idlest_reg;
 	u32			autoidle_mask;
@@ -167,7 +166,6 @@ struct dpll_data {
 	u8			auto_recal_bit;
 	u8			recal_en_bit;
 	u8			recal_st_bit;
-#  endif
 	u8			flags;
 };

--
1.7.0.4


^ permalink raw reply related	[flat|nested] 12+ messages in thread

end of thread, other threads:[~2012-06-18 20:19 UTC | newest]

Thread overview: 12+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2012-05-11  6:02 [PATCH] ARM: OMAP2+: CLEANUP: Remove ARCH_OMAPx ifdef from struct dpll_data Vaibhav Hiremath
2012-05-11  6:02 ` Vaibhav Hiremath
2012-05-11  6:31 ` Shilimkar, Santosh
2012-05-11  6:31   ` Shilimkar, Santosh
2012-05-14 22:24 ` Kevin Hilman
2012-05-14 22:24   ` Kevin Hilman
2012-05-15  5:41   ` Hiremath, Vaibhav
2012-05-15  5:41     ` Hiremath, Vaibhav
2012-06-18 20:19     ` Paul Walmsley
2012-06-18 20:19       ` Paul Walmsley
2012-06-14 15:01   ` Hiremath, Vaibhav
2012-06-14 15:01     ` Hiremath, Vaibhav

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.